    Well I finished the New Forest Marathon in 4.05.04 which I was really pleased with as it was a fairly undulatinmg. So 3 marathons under my belt.

    Race Report New Forest Marathon

    There were 3 of us from my running club doing this race so we all travelled toegther. unfortunately it was my turn to drive so a 2 hour drive starting at 6.15 am.

    Got to the start with ample spare time and for once there was a plentiful supply of toilets.

    The plan was for the 3 us of to run together  (all of us are 49 so have gone race crazy!) . It was perfect running conditions slightly overcast but dry. Myself and the lady I run with a lot decided that we would aim for 9.30 minute miles. However, we found running that slow quite difficult. The other chap in our group is  aliitle slower than us hence the 9,30 pace. However, he was finidng it quite hard work with his breathing in the first few miles. Probably not helped by me constantly going sub 9 minutes. Anyway, the scenary was great and we were running through country lanes and trails.

    Myself and the lady from my club were finidng it a bit difficult waiting at each water stop and after about mile 11 the chap told us to go on. It was at this point that we slotted into a nice comfotable pace of around 8.45-9.15 minute miles. After about mile 18 it was great to realise that we weren't going to hit the wall & we started overtaking a lot of people. It was nice to here people say "well done you two" they probably mumbled under their breaths as we passed the - not nad for some oldies!!!

    There was a mega hill at mile 22 which we decided to walk up and cosnerve our energy. At the top my friend asked me how were we doing on time and I told her. She then informed me that her Marathon PB was 4.08 so I menatlly calculated that we could get her a PB.So I upped the pace for the last 3 miles she sent me on at the last 3/4 mile but still crossed the line in 4.05.40 so was really chuffed that she got a PB on a tough course. We felt a little quilty about not waiting for the third member of the 49 club,but he didn't finish until about 15 minutes afterwards and was fine about us going ahead & was pleased with our times. 

    So a great day out & marathon No 4 is booked - The Beachy Head Marthon on 26/10 with No5 likely to be the Portsmouth Coastal Marathon on 22/12.
